PDFs readable to Acrobat 5?
Can the newer versions of Acrobat create a PDF that is readable to Acrobat 5? I get a number of PDFs that my (Acrobat 5) cannot read correctly. Can I tell the agencies sending me these PDFs to make them readable to Acrobat 5? I cannot upgrade from 5 at this time as it is the newest version my Mac will run. Thanks for any ideas. - Dennis

sws@adobeforums.com #2
Re: PDFs readable to Acrobat 5?
In Acrobat 6 or 7, go to File > Reduce File Size..., or, if you have the Pro version you can use the Optimizer in the Advanced menu.

Re: PDFs readable to Acrobat 5?
Or if you setup Distiller to use Acrobat 5/1.4 compatibility as one of its settings files and have Distiller use that file; Acrobat will create them Acrobat 5 format "as long as" you do "Save As"; and "not" "Save".
If you use "Save" it saves in native format regardless of how Distiller is set.
